About Thekla Kiffmeyer
Thekla Kiffmeyer is a scholar working on Chemical Health and Safety, Occupational Therapy and Pollution, having authored 12 papers that have together received 633 indexed citations. Recurring topics across this work include Safe Handling of Antineoplastic Drugs (5 papers), Pharmaceutical and Antibiotic Environmental Impacts (4 papers), Antibiotics Pharmacokinetics and Efficacy (4 papers), Pharmaceutical studies and practices (4 papers), Analytical Chemistry and Chromatography (3 papers), Analytical Methods in Pharmaceuticals (2 papers), Synthesis and bioactivity of alkaloids (1 paper) and Innovative Microfluidic and Catalytic Techniques Innovation (1 paper). The work is most often cited by research in Chemical Health and Safety (47 citations), Occupational Therapy (200 citations) and Pollution (233 citations). Thekla Kiffmeyer has collaborated with scholars based in Germany and Switzerland. Frequent co-authors include Jochen Tuerk, K. G. Schmidt, S.A.I. Mohring, Gerd Hamscher, Thorsten Teutenberg, Hans‐Jürgen Götze, Hartmut Stuetzer, Moritz Hahn, P.J.M. Sessink and T. Rohe. Their work appears in journals such as Environmental Science & Technology, Journal of Chromatography A and Water Science & Technology.
